NUT & WASHER — GRADE MATCHING REQUIRED Hex NUT CROSS-SECTION WASHER OD: — SIZE: — MATERIAL: — PN: 53502 · Dataflex ⚠ VERIFY BEFORE ORDERING Grade matters for torque spec — don't mix grades. A Grade 5 nut on a Grade 8 bolt weakens the joint. Lock nuts, wing nuts, and castle nuts are NOT interchangeable with standard hex ✓ BROKER TIP Match nut to bolt thread class and material. Stainless bolt + zinc nut = galvanic corrosion. Always verify finish matches (plain, zinc, hot-dip galvanized) PARTSTABLE TECHNICAL DRAWING — NOT TO SCALE
